Unforgettable Stories: Indie Games of 2023
Some indie games just knock storytelling out of the park, you know? In 2023, a few titles stood tall for their captivating plots and deep character development. Take “Dredge” for example.
It’s a haunting tale of a fisherman battling more than just the waves, relying on eerie storytelling techniques to cast a spell. Players felt the chill of isolation and mystery, hooked by the emotional tides the game stirred.
“Goodbye Volcano High” also deserves a shoutout. The game dives deep into adolescent struggles, blending dinosaurs with the end of the world to explore themes of identity and change. It’s a narrative rollercoaster that resonated because, let’s face it, we’re all a bit terrified of endings.
The storytelling here isn’t just about words; it’s about feelings.
Then there’s “Sea of Stars,” which plays like a love letter to classic RPGs while tackling issues of destiny and choice. The narrative balances light-hearted adventure with weighty themes, drawing players into its world effortlessly.

Beyond the Familiar: Indie Games of 2023
Indie games 2023? Oh, they were something else. Let’s talk about how they shook things up.
Take “Dave the Diver” for instance. Ever thought diving could be thrilling in a game? This one made it a core mechanic, blending exploration with strategic management.
I mean, who knew managing a sushi restaurant could feel so intense?
Then there’s “Jusant.” This game redefined climbing mechanics. It wasn’t just about getting from point A to B. It was a puzzle, requiring you to think vertically.
You felt every grip and slip, which made reaching the top satisfying. It was like a new sport, but on your screen.
And “Cocoon”. Wow. It took puzzle-solving to a whole new level.
It wasn’t your typical puzzle game. The way it played with perspective and layers was genius. You’d solve one puzzle, only to find it was part of a bigger one.
It was that “aha!” moment that kept you hooked.

Discover the Next Indie Masterpiece: Your Ultimate Guide
Let’s face it, finding the next indie hit is like searching for a needle in a haystack. Exciting yet overwhelming. I get it.
You’re hungry for more indie games 2023 and beyond. Here’s my take: start by following the trailblazers in indie publishing. Think Annapurna Interactive and Devolver Digital.
They know their stuff.
Then, keep your eyes glued to platforms like Steam’s indie spotlight and Itch.io. They’re goldmines. Plus, the Epic Games Store sometimes has free indie titles. (Who doesn’t love free stuff?) But don’t stop there.
Dive into indie game showcases. Summer Game Fest, PAX Rising, and Indie World Showcases are your best friends. Trust me.
Want deeper takeaways? Specialized indie game journalism and podcasts can be enlightening. YouTube channels zeroing in on the indie scene are worth your time too.
